Output 3ddcf0eebd94f7b78471e269290031d5089ea1966e884ba6b692c5bb18374309:0

value
20937
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f11d2d71e559d36996c9afdcd30b37dba71860 OP_EQUALVERIFY OP_CHECKSIG
address
166o1SiNQgbATUeJ3FP13KZcYyUwFFNLp2
transaction
3ddcf0eebd94f7b78471e269290031d5089ea1966e884ba6b692c5bb18374309
spent
true